Salman threatens to go off Twitter

June 10, 2015 03:11 pm | Updated November 16, 2021 05:01 pm IST - Mumbai

Salman said he joined social media just to “spread love”.

Bollywood superstar Salman Khan has warned his followers to stop posting abusive comments to his colleagues Shah Rukh Khan and Aamir Khan on Twitter. He has threatened to quit the micro-blogging site, as he said all three of them are “friends” and there is no number game in the industry.

The 49-year-old, who shares a massive 12.3 million followers on Twitter, seemed upset with his fans and wrote:

In a series of posts, the “Dabangg” star said that he joined social media just to “spread love”, but is unhappy with his “die hard fans”, who are using their fake accounts to write against his colleagues.

("As it is I tweet less, don’t force me to stop completely".)

Salman resolved his long time rivalry with Shah Rukh last year and since then, the film industry’s ruling trinity have presented a united front to the world.

He even took a stand for Shah Rukh and Aamir, and wrote:

In fact, SRK and Aamir had last month lent support to Salman’s new film “Bajrangi Bhaijaan” by > sharing its teaser with their own fan s.
